Transaction 31c5860becf4235f2bb29cf3dd5d53c2e4ab3896eaea1ac1b79d176e38070b85
1 Input
1 Output
-
31c5860becf4235f2bb29cf3dd5d53c2e4ab3896eaea1ac1b79d176e38070b85:0
- value
- 751080
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c2a488b21d48c90287739869eaa0f2533e7388d0 OP_EQUAL
- address
- 3KSC7nA1FkuQ4KE3CMRr2fwrVsN98zkHhz